Quick answers about Skai
How many people are named Skai?
An estimated 1,044 living Americans are named Skai.
How rare is Skai?
Skai is uncommon among babies today, with 66 girls receiving the name in 2025, down 28.3% from its 2021 peak.
How old is the typical Skai?
The median age of a living American named Skai is approximately 8 years, with most bearers falling between 4 and 12 years old.
Is Skai still popular?
Yes — Skai is currently rising in popularity, with 66 births in 2025. Births this decade are running about 2.8× higher than the previous decade.
Where is Skai most common?
Skai has its strongest geographic signal in Florida, where it appears 3.0× more often than the national baseline.
